Buying Guide: Key Considerations For Choosing The Right 10-Inch Wheel
- Axle bore compatibility: Most options use a 5/8″ bore. Confirm your axle diameter and whether your setup requires 3/4″ or 1/2″ bearings or spacers for proper fit.
- Hub offset and width: Offsets around 2.2″ help maintain alignment on hand trucks and dollies. Check your frame clearance and hub length to prevent rubbing or misalignment.
- Load capacity: Choose wheels that can handle your typical load. Many options list per-wheel capacities ranging from ~220 lbs to 500 lbs. Multiply by the number of wheels in use for total capacity.
- Flat-free design vs. pneumatic: Flat-free PU or rubber tires reduce maintenance and puncture risk, but some users prefer pneumatic tires for smoother rides on rough terrain. Consider the terrain you work on most.
- Compatibility with accessories: Some sets include a wide range of bearings, spacers, and adapters. If you plan to reuse an existing axle or frame, ensure the included hardware matches your needs.
- Application scope: While these wheels are marketed for hand trucks, dollies, wheelbarrows, and garden carts, verify intended use (indoor, outdoor, heavy-duty) and static vs. dynamic loading requirements.
Frequently Asked Questions
- What does the 5/8″ axle bore mean for compatibility? It means the wheel is designed to fit axles with a 5/8″ inner diameter; confirm if your axle is 5/8″, or if adapters are included to fit other sizes.
- Are these wheels suitable for long-term static parking? Some entries note they’re not ideal for long-term static parking; consider a different wheel if the equipment will be stationary for extended periods.
- Do these sets include all necessary bearings and spacers? Several sets include 3/4″ and 1/2″ bearings and spacers, but always check the product’s kit contents to ensure you have what you need for your axle and frame.
- Can I use these wheels on different equipment? These 10″ solid wheels fit a variety of equipment, including hand trucks, dollies, generators, and wheelbarrows, but verify the tire width, bore, and hub length for an exact fit.
- What are the advantages of flat-free tires? Flat-free tires eliminate punctures and frequent inflation, reducing maintenance and downtime in busy work environments.
- Is there a risk with quick adapter changes? Some kits require careful alignment of spacers and pins; improper assembly can cause wobble or misfit. Always follow included assembly guidance.
